Transaction 07ddbbcae419ad1abfc07e1a6304950151a5c18caf18c25903f3fe465192ad09

3 Input
2 Outputs
  • 07ddbbcae419ad1abfc07e1a6304950151a5c18caf18c25903f3fe465192ad09:0
  • value  9698
    address  3FvKH4ehB3LedM82AshvD3Sd9dfPeGY2Gx
  • 07ddbbcae419ad1abfc07e1a6304950151a5c18caf18c25903f3fe465192ad09:1
  • value  2564000
    address  3GikgAfRHDPW7vd84YnHUdmJyQfP7vEWAz